Futaba Bunko / The head of a hatamoto family suddenly disappeared after the coming-of-age ceremony for his legitimate son. Ordered by OKUBO Chuzaemon, a yoriki (police sergeant) of Kenbikata (inspector), SHIRANUI no Hanbei, a temporary mawari doshin (police constable), decided to look for the hatamoto. This is the 17th installment of the popular Kakioroshi series, which depicts the humanity of Hanbei, who shouts, "There are things in the world that it is better to make a face that you don't know."
